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ree accredited four-year college/university in chemistry or other related science with sufficient chemistry courses (minimally general, organic, and analytical) or equivalent experience.
  • Minimum of three (3) years of recent work experience as a Forensic Drug Chemist working as a bench analyst within an ISO/IEC 17025 forensic laboratory is required.
  • Successful completion of a formal documented casework training program from an accredited forensic laboratory in forensic drug analysis and/or demonstration of competency.
  • Knowledge of basic theoretical principles and applications of the instrumentation and methodologies used to analyze controlled substances (e.g., Color Tests, GC, GC/MS, FTIR) and performing microscope and chemical tests.
  • Knowledge of laboratory safety procedures, quality assurance/quality control, and laboratory practices; instrumental analysis and experience in forensic drug analysis.
  • Must be flexible and have the ability to travel to other laboratories in Mississippi if required.

Responsibilities

  • Provide expert technical assistance to law enforcement agencies in analyzing controlled substances, following MSFL policies, Standard Operating Procedures, and ISO/IEC 17025:2017 accreditation requirements.
  • Facilitate the receipt, tracking, and secure storage of samples related to drug cases, adhering to the chain of custody requirements.
  • Coordinate and perform a range of drug identification tests, including Color Tests, Gas Chromatography (GC), Gas Chromatography-Mass Spectrometry (GC/MS), and Fourier-Transform Infrared Spectroscopy (FTIR).
  • Document findings in a thorough manner and prepare comprehensive reports.
  • Ensure that all activities are performed in compliance with ISO/IEC 17025 accreditation standards and that lab safety procedures are strictly followed.
